Brent crude oil, the international standard, lost 15 cents to $57.17 a barrel. The slide in oil prices has weighed on energy stocks. The sector is the biggest loser in the S&P 500, down 10.2% so far …
More Asian markets mixed: Japan skids; China helped by rate cut Videos